Transaction 56d351f1637d69236a5938667603cde749684185768aa24734bfe50315535f6c

1 Input
2 Outputs
  • 56d351f1637d69236a5938667603cde749684185768aa24734bfe50315535f6c:0
  • value  1500000
    address  19AcXbQoheNSyTNPqcMNzdfeQNwQvLHYFa
  • 56d351f1637d69236a5938667603cde749684185768aa24734bfe50315535f6c:1
  • value  40627610
    address  3PE4mHKACRh8BKRUZDiP5Ga7p5pcieHP9r